mac怎么安装game proting toolkit mac安装flutter教程
0
2026-01-09
推荐通过Homebrew安装Flutter:先检查或安装Homebrew,再执行brew install --cask flutter并验证版本;中国大陆用户可选清华镜像手动配置SDK;Apple Silicon Mac需启用Rosetta 2;必须安装Xcode并配置命令行工具;最后运行flutter doctor完成环境检测。
一、通过Homebrew安装Flutter(推荐)
Homebrew是macOS上最主流的包管理工具,使用它安装 Flutter 可以自动处理依赖、简化更新流程,并避免手动配置 PATH 的常见错误。该方式适用于已安装 Homebrew 且网络环境稳定(或已配置镜像)的用户。
1、检查则安装 Homebrew:在终端中执行 brew --version,若返回版本号跳过下一步;否则执行安装命令。
2、安装 Homebrew(如未安装):/bin/bash -c "$(卷曲-f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"。
3、添加Dart官方仓库并安装Dart(可选,Flutter自带Dart):brew tap dart-lang/dart brew install dart。
4、安装Flutter:brew install --cask flutter。
5、验证安装:flutter --version,成功将显示当前Flutter版本号。二、从清华镜像手动下载并配置SDK
中国针对大陆用户,直接访问官方服务器常因网络限制失败。使用清华大学镜像源成功可显着提升下载率与速度,并确保SDK缺陷。此方法不依赖Homebrew,适合离线部署或需精准控制SDK版本场景的。
1、创建开发目录并进入:mkdir -p ~/development cd ~/development。
2、来自清华镜像克隆稳定版Flutter SDK:git clone https://mirrors.tuna.tsinghua.edu.cn/git/flutter-sdk.git flutter -b stable。
3、编辑shell配置文件(macOS Catalina及更新默认系统为zsh):nano ~/.zshrc。
4、在文件中添加三行环境变量:
export PUB_HOSTED_URL=https://mirrors.tuna.tsinghua.edu.cn/dart-pub
export FLUTTER_STORAGE_BASE_URL=https://mirrors.tuna.tsinghua.edu.cn/flutter
export PATH="$PATH:$HOME/development/flutter/bin"
5、保存后执行:source ~/.zshrc,使配置立即生效。
三、配置 Rosetta 2(Apple Silicon Mac 必须)
在运行部分装载 M1/M2/M3 芯片的 Mac Flutter 工具链(例如某些 iOS 构建工具、模拟器组件)时需要通过 Rosetta 2 进行指令集转译。若跳过此步骤,后续 flutter doctor 可能会报错“xcrun:错误:无效的活动开发人员路径”或无法启动 iOS 模拟器。